How to uninstall symantec endpoint protection 12.1 client version without password

I have installed a client version 12.1 of Symantec Endpoint Protection.Now I have to uninstall the SEP in 2008 R2 server.When trying this I am prompted with a empty box which has to be filled with the password of SEP .I have forgotten the password.Could anyone help me to uninstall the SEP client without the password.

NOTE: Uninstall Password would come up only when this policy is set. Check the Policy from SEPM> Clients > Policies > General-security settings.

Use the following to disable password and remove the product.

1. Open the registry
2. Navigate to H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Symantec\Symantec Endpoint Protection\SMC
3. Change the value for SmcGuiHasPassword from 1 to 0
4. Restart the SMC service

Then uninstall the product :)

 you don't have any uninstall password change registry setting.

H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Symantec\Symantec Endpoint Protection\AV\AdministratorOnly\Security\UseVPUninstallPassword

Set to 0 to disable

There are two ways i.e. either remove it from SEPM console or Change the registry settings on the machine itself.

There is no default password set when you first install SEPM first time.
